Abstract
2-Amino-1-ethylbenzimidazole (L1) adducts with copper(II), cobalt(II), and zinc(II) chelates of N,N,S tridentate tosylamino-functionalized mercaptopyrazole-containing Schiff base (H2L), resulting from condensation of 2-tosylaminoaniline with 1-phenyl-3-methyl-4-formylpyrazole-5-thiol, with the general formula [ML · L1] were obtained by electrochemical method. The structure and composition of the complexes were confirmed by the data of C, H, N elemental analysis, IR and 1H NMR spectroscopy, and magnetochemical and X-ray spectral measurements. The mononuclear structure of the copper(II) adduct with coordination bond located on the pyridine type endocyclic nitrogen atom of 2-amino-1-ethylbenzimidazole was proved by X-ray diffraction.
